Abstract :
This paper reports a micromachined corona discharger with slit dielectric barrier for measuring the number concentration of airborne particle. The tip-to-plate corona discharger presented in our previous research only generates the corona discharge on the tip type electrode. However, the proposed corona discharger generates the corona discharge on the slit dielectric barrier as well as the tip type discharge electrode. The discharge characteristic and particle charging capability of the proposed corona discharger were experimentally examined. At the result, the corona current and induced current by charged particles were 3 times higher than those of the tip-to-pate micro corona discharger.
